>> Similar to HID sensor stack, the new driver sits between cros_ec_dev
>> and the iio device drivers:
>>
>> EC based iio device topology would be:
>> iio:device1 ->
>> ...0/0000:00:1f.0/PNP0C09:00/GOOG0004:00/cros-ec-dev.6.auto/
>>                                          cros-ec-sensorhub.7.auto/
>>                                          cros-ec-accel.15.auto/
>>                                          iio:device1
>>
>> It will be expanded to control EC sensor FIFO.

>> +config CROS_EC_SENSORHUB
>> +    tristate "ChromeOS EC MEMS Sensor Hub"
>> +    depends on CROS_EC && IIO
>> +    help
>> +      Allow loading IIO sensors. This driver is loaded by MFD and will in
>> +      turn query the EC and register the sensors.
>> +      It also spreads the sensor data coming from the EC to the IIO sensor
>> +      object.
>> +
>> +      To compile this driver as a module, choose M here: the
>> +      module will be called cros_ec_sensorhub.
